Rangers boss Giovanni van Bronckhorst insists his side are not taking Borussia Dortmund lightly - even if they are without Erling Haaland.
The Norwegian attacker is still absent through injury, and will miss the first leg of the Europa League round of 32 tie in Germany on Thursday between the two sides.
However, Van Bronckhorst acknowledged that Dortmund have more than enough quality to threaten Rangers, even without Haaland.
"Everyone recognises the talent he has, he is one of the top strikers in the world," said Van Bronckhorst, per Sky Sports.
"But Dortmund have been playing without him for weeks, so for me it is just about preparing for the players we will face.
"He is almost back to play, but it looks like he is not in the squad for Thursday."
